The Role

As a Service Reliability Engineer, you will be at the forefront of maintaining and enhancing the reliability of our production applications and services, particularly focusing on acquiring and scheme-related transactional support activities. You'll work within AWS infrastructure, supporting multiple technology stacks to ensure high availability, low latency, and exceptional performance of our payment systems.

Additionally you will be responsible for:

  • Developing a deep understanding of our clients, applications, and infrastructure to provide effective support and maintain system stability;
  • Resolving integration issues, support API services, and troubleshoot production/project issues while adhering to ITIL framework procedures;
  • Utilising tools like CloudWatch and New Relic to build, operate, and maintain system and application monitoring and health checks.;
  • Maintaining PCI DSS compliance and assist with annual audits, ensuring our payment systems' security and integrity;
  • Act as the first responder to critical alerts and incidents, collaborating with Incident Managers for swift resolution of major issues;
  • Document and enhance existing processes, providing training and support to other analysts for knowledge transfer and supportability of new products;
  • Keep clients and internal teams informed of issue resolutions and software releases, fostering strong working relationships with technical stakeholders.

You will also bring:

  • Tertiary Qualification in Information Technology or equivalent;
  • 3+ years of commercial IT experience;
  • Proficiency in cloud technologies like AWS and Azure;
  • Knowledge of DBMS technologies (Oracle/Microsoft SQL Server)
  • Experience with .NET, C#, XML, SOAP, REST, and Web Services;
  • Understanding of software development lifecycle and ITIL practices;
  • Ability to acquire a broad understanding of integration architectures and APIs;
  • Strong problem-solving, process analysis, and troubleshooting skills;
  • Knowledge of the software development lifecycle and ITIL practices;
  • Experience with Monitoring and Alerting Tools like Newrelic, Victor Ops, Opsgenie, Sumologic;
  • Excellent relationship management skills.
